Police Rescue 5 Victims, Arrest 2 Terrorists In Katsina

Katsina State Police Command said its troops have rescued five kidnapped victims and arrested two suspected bandits during operation.

A statement issued by the state police spokesman, Gambo Isah, explained that the troops responded to a distress call that terrorists in their numbers, shooting sporadically with AK 47 rifles, attacked Unguwar Rinji, Ruwayu village, Kurfi local government area and kidnapped one Alhaji Ali and four others.

It added that the DPO in charge of Kurfi led a tactical team to block the exit route of the terrorists and in the spur of the moment, engaged the terrorists in a fierce gunfight where they successfully repelled them.

He said, ” The team succeeded in rescuing all the kidnap victims. In the course of scanning the scene, it was reasonably believed that many terrorists escaped the scene with gunshot wounds.”

The spokesman said based on credible intelligence, the command also succeeded in arresting two suspected terrorists and recovered eight rustled cows and two sheep.

“Nemesis caught up with the duo of one Rabiu Umar, aged 25yrs of Salihawa village, Matazu LGA, and Surajo Lawal, alias ‘ORI, aged 30yrs of Rimin Kanwa village, in possession of 8 rustled cows and 2 sheep at Gidan Kanya, Sukuntani village, Kankia, property of one Abubakar Amadu, of Tafashiya village, Kankia.

“In the course of the investigation, suspects confessed to the commission of the offence and stated that on 30th of November 2022, they criminally conspired with the following terrorists (now at large) Bala Usman, of Gabace village Kankia, Samaila Sule, of Salihawa, Matazu, Idi Uba, of Kanwa village, Kankia and attacked the house of the victim with dangerous weapons and robbed him of the animals.

“The rustled animals were recovered while effort is in top gear with a view of arresting the other members of the syndicate. The investigation is ongoing,” he said.
